What is OMO model?

The OMO model is the one that merges the online and offline worlds to create an experience unlimited by locations and time. This model integrates the offline, tangible interaction with virtual, live-streaming events. Similarly, OMO-powered exhibition model combines live-streaming conferences and real-world trade fair experiences, where online sections complement offline and allow exhibitors to seize the advantages of both.

First Launch of OMO-Driven Education Fair

This June, didac China aims to launch the first OMO-powered international education fair. During the 3-day exhibition at Shanghai World Expo Exhibition & Conference Center, 30,000 educators and families will be able to participate 600+ hands-on activities, 1200 products presentation, 180+ education forums and lectures, as well as 50+ business matchmaking sessions.

As for the online section, 1000+ Chinese streaming broadcasts & 200+ international live streaming will reach out to over 3,000,000 educators and families all over the world. Overseas exhibitors will be able to showcase their cutting-edge products at didac online platform and interact with potential buyers.
